Method decode4to3

samples/JGroups/src/S3_PING.java:2221–2277  ·  view source on GitHub ↗

Decodes four bytes from array source and writes the resulting bytes (up to three of them) to destination . The source and destination arrays can be manipulated anywhere along their length by specifying srcOffset and destOffset . This method does not check to

(byte[] source, int srcOffset, byte[] destination, int destOffset)

2221 private static int decode4to3(byte[] source, int srcOffset, byte[] destination, int destOffset) {
2222 // Example: Dk==
2223 if(source[srcOffset + 2] == EQUALS_SIGN) {
2224 // Two ways to do the same thing. Don't know which way I like best.
2225 //int outBuff = ( ( DECODABET[ source[ srcOffset ] ] << 24 ) >>> 6 )
2226 // | ( ( DECODABET[ source[ srcOffset + 1] ] << 24 ) >>> 12 );
2227 int outBuff=((DECODABET[source[srcOffset]] & 0xFF) << 18)
2228 | ((DECODABET[source[srcOffset + 1]] & 0xFF) << 12);
2229
2230 destination[destOffset]=(byte)(outBuff >>> 16);
2231 return 1;
2232 }
2233
2234 // Example: DkL=
2235 else if(source[srcOffset + 3] == EQUALS_SIGN) {
2236 // Two ways to do the same thing. Don't know which way I like best.
2237 //int outBuff = ( ( DECODABET[ source[ srcOffset ] ] << 24 ) >>> 6 )
2238 // | ( ( DECODABET[ source[ srcOffset + 1 ] ] << 24 ) >>> 12 )
2239 // | ( ( DECODABET[ source[ srcOffset + 2 ] ] << 24 ) >>> 18 );
2240 int outBuff=((DECODABET[source[srcOffset]] & 0xFF) << 18)
2241 | ((DECODABET[source[srcOffset + 1]] & 0xFF) << 12)
2242 | ((DECODABET[source[srcOffset + 2]] & 0xFF) << 6);
2243
2244 destination[destOffset]=(byte)(outBuff >>> 16);
2245 destination[destOffset + 1]=(byte)(outBuff >>> 8);
2246 return 2;
2247 }
2248
2249 // Example: DkLE
2250 else {
2251 try {
2252 // Two ways to do the same thing. Don't know which way I like best.
2253 //int outBuff = ( ( DECODABET[ source[ srcOffset ] ] << 24 ) >>> 6 )
2254 // | ( ( DECODABET[ source[ srcOffset + 1 ] ] << 24 ) >>> 12 )
2255 // | ( ( DECODABET[ source[ srcOffset + 2 ] ] << 24 ) >>> 18 )
2256 // | ( ( DECODABET[ source[ srcOffset + 3 ] ] << 24 ) >>> 24 );
2257 int outBuff=((DECODABET[source[srcOffset]] & 0xFF) << 18)
2258 | ((DECODABET[source[srcOffset + 1]] & 0xFF) << 12)
2259 | ((DECODABET[source[srcOffset + 2]] & 0xFF) << 6)
2260 | ((DECODABET[source[srcOffset + 3]] & 0xFF));
2261
2262
2263 destination[destOffset]=(byte)(outBuff >> 16);
2264 destination[destOffset + 1]=(byte)(outBuff >> 8);
2265 destination[destOffset + 2]=(byte)(outBuff);
2266
2267 return 3;
2268 }
2269 catch(Exception e) {
2270 System.out.println(valueOf(source[srcOffset]) + ": " + (DECODABET[source[srcOffset]]));
2271 System.out.println(valueOf(source[srcOffset + 1]) + ": " + (DECODABET[source[srcOffset + 1]]));
2272 System.out.println(valueOf(source[srcOffset + 2]) + ": " + (DECODABET[source[srcOffset + 2]]));
2273 System.out.println(String.valueOf(source[srcOffset + 3]) + ": " + (DECODABET[source[srcOffset + 3]]));
2274 return -1;
2275 } //e nd catch
2276 }
2277 } // end decodeToBytes
